In addition there is a Society in each of the Ecclesiastical Wards of the County. The names of the various societies and of the Presidents are as follows:

Martha A. Critchlow Ogden (1st Ward.)
Mary A. Ellis Ogden (2nd Ward.)
Lucretia B. Farr Ogden (3rd Ward.)
Marianna Stratford Ogden (4th Ward.)
Margaret Mc Bride Eden.
Eliza A. Tracy Huntsville.
Almira Raymond Plain City.
Mary Chadwick North Ogden.
Mrs. Maycock Pleasant View.
Mary Hegstead Harrisville (West end.)
Melissa Shurtliff Harrisville (East end)
Mary Bird Lynne.
Annie Taylor Mound Fort.
Ann Fields Slaterville.
Ann Bickington Marriott.
Mrs. Adeline Belnap Hooper.
Mary Douglass West Weber.
Jeannette Bingham Wilson's Lane.
Rhoda Dye Uintah.
Martha A. Bingham Riverdale.

An out-growth of the Relief Society of this County are the associations for young People. Several years ago, before there were any such organizations as now for Mutual Improvement, Apostle Richards and Mrs. Jane S. Richards inaugurated a series of meetings for the young gentlemen and ladies of the community which were so beneficial in their results, that they have been continued until the present time—though now under the names which follow in the two succeeding titles:
